Dolly Parton’s Imagination Library is a national early literacy program that mails free high quality and age-appropriate books each month to children from birth to age five. This program has planting the seeds for families to build home libraries and foster a lifelong love of reading. In Hamilton County, the program is supported locally through community partners to ensure that more children have access to books and early literacy support right at home.
